MLS teams hold a 57% implied probability in the Leagues Cup 2026 "Winning League" market, driven by their three straight tournament titles and strong Phase One results that placed multiple clubs like Chicago Fire FC, Austin FC, and Columbus Crew atop league-specific tables. Recent form favors MLS sides, who benefit from midseason rhythm after the 2026 World Cup pause, deeper squads, and home advantage in the majority of cross-border fixtures. Liga MX clubs, including early standouts León and América, face challenges from an early Apertura schedule and fewer games on familiar turf despite competitive head-to-head history. Knockout matchups beginning August 25 will test these edges in a single-elimination format where recent MLS consistency and roster depth continue to shape trader consensus.
